Summary of Bill HRES 1277

Bill 118 HRES 1277 is a response to the Safeguarding National Security Ordinance enacted by the Hong Kong Special Administrative Region Government on March 19, 2024. The Ordinance, implemented under Article 23 of the Basic Law, has raised concerns about potential violations of human rights and freedoms in Hong Kong.

The Bill aims to address these concerns by calling for a comprehensive review of the Ordinance and its impact on the people of Hong Kong. It also seeks to hold the Hong Kong government accountable for any violations of international law and agreements related to human rights and freedoms.

Additionally, Bill 118 HRES 1277 urges the United States government to take diplomatic action to address the situation in Hong Kong and to support efforts to protect the rights and freedoms of the people living there. Overall, this Bill highlights the importance of upholding human rights and freedoms in Hong Kong and calls for action to address any violations that may occur as a result of the Safeguarding National Security Ordinance.

Current Status of Bill HRES 1277

Bill HRES 1277 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since June 4, 2024. Bill HRES 1277 was introduced during Congress 118 and was introduced to the House on June 4, 2024.  Bill HRES 1277's most recent activity was Referred to the House Committee on Foreign Affairs. as of June 4, 2024
